❤️ HAPPY 5TH YEAR WEDDING ANNIVERSARY TO THE DUKE AND DUCHESS OF SUSSEX! ❤️
(may 19, 2018 - may 19, 2023) Today marks the 5th wedding anniversary of The Duke and Duchess of Sussex who got married at the St. George chapel in Windsor.
“I appreciate, respect and honor you, my treasure, for the family we will create, and our love story that will last forever.”— Meghan, The Duchess of Sussex. Extracted from The Duchess wedding's speech to her husband.
“Amazing that I could even hear the music over the sound of my own heartbeat as Meg stepped up, took my hand. The present dissolved, the past came rushing back.”— Prince Harry, The Duke of Sussex. Extracted from Spare.
